Output f3594e6c61caa766aa2c2aecb4cf44cfac4766f539d5246bd9fe1dbfbcb0cef6:1

value
1390346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850665b8cba96440df92bcc556b56ea2096feb71 OP_EQUAL
address
3DpPTZ2LuGSS8XjAL4axhozAw2a16uSDcZ
transaction
f3594e6c61caa766aa2c2aecb4cf44cfac4766f539d5246bd9fe1dbfbcb0cef6
confirmations
272825
spent
true